Why a 6-dimension framework?
Most AI assessments treat AI literacy as binary — you either “know AI” or you don't. We disagree. AI skill is multi-dimensional: you can be strong at understanding how AI works (L1) but weak at evaluating its outputs critically (F2). A single score misses everything that matters for workplace readiness.
Our framework separates Literacy (conceptual understanding) from Fluency (practical skill), giving organizations a precise, actionable picture of where to invest.

The Assessment Framework
| Code | Dimension | What It Measures | Type |
|---|---|---|---|
| L1 | AI Foundations | Understanding of models, training, capabilities, and limitations | Literacy |
| L2 | Ethics & Critical Thinking | Recognizing bias, hallucinations, privacy risks, and ethical trade-offs | Literacy |
| L3 | Strategic Judgment | Knowing when to use AI, when not to, and how to apply it strategically | Literacy |
| F1 | Prompting Craft | Writing effective prompts that produce consistently high-quality outputs | Fluency |
| F2 | Evaluation & Verification | Critically assessing, fact-checking, and refining AI-generated content | Fluency |
| F3 | Workflow Integration | Designing repeatable processes that embed AI into real work | Fluency |
